Kinds Of Fencing Products Available



When selecting a fencing service, house owners have a selection of materials at their disposal, each offering one-of-a-kind benefits and appearances. Wood is a popular choice, offering an all-natural appearance and superb privacy, though it needs normal upkeep to avoid rot. Vinyl fence is another choice, known for its longevity and low maintenance, readily available in numerous colors and designs. Chain-link fences are frequently preferred for their affordability and exposure, making them ideal for security without obstructing views. Metal fences, such as light weight aluminum or wrought iron, deal toughness and style, while additionally requiring minimal maintenance. Compound materials combine the finest top qualities of timber and plastic, providing a tough, eco-friendly option. Finally, bamboo fence provides an unique aesthetic while being sustainable. Each product offers unique advantages, enabling homeowners to pick the excellent secure fencing service based on their demands and choices.

Regional Laws Considerations



Understanding local guidelines is necessary for house owners in San Diego, as they dictate the permitted elevation for fences based upon home type and neighborhood. These laws differ across different zones, with suburbs commonly enabling fences up to six feet tall, while some business zones might allow better heights. Home owners should also think about specific demands, such as troubles from residential or commercial property lines and presence constraints at intersections. Furthermore, specific areas might have Homeowners Association (HOA) standards that enforce more restrictions on fencing height and style. To assure compliance and prevent potential penalties or disagreements, it is advisable for home owners to consult local zoning statutes and engage with their HOA if relevant before finalizing fencing plans.

Maintenance Tips for Long Life and Performance



Preserving the durability and efficiency of secure fencing needs regular upkeep and interest to detail. House owners need to routinely check their fences for indicators of wear, such as loose boards, rust, or decaying materials. Trigger repairs can protect against small concerns from escalating into pricey replacements.


Cleaning up the fence frequently is critical, specifically for timber and plastic materials that might collect dirt and mold. A simple service of soap and water can efficiently restore the fencing's appearance.




Furthermore, using a safety sealer kc fence contractors to wooden fences every few years can boost resistance to moisture and bugs. For metal fences, a protective finish can defend against rust.


Lastly, trimming vegetation near the fencing line will certainly avoid overgrowth that can create damage. By following these upkeep ideas, house owners can extend the life of their fences and assure peak efficiency in time.

Can I Install a Fence on My Residential Property Line?



Yes, one can mount a fencing on their residential or commercial property line, supplied regional guidelines and zoning laws are followed. It is a good idea to consult regional authorities and neighbors to stay clear of legal concerns or prospective conflicts.


What Permits Are Required for Setting Up a Fencing in San Diego?



In San Diego, a homeowner commonly requires a building license for fence installment, particularly for structures going beyond six feet in height (fence company san diego). It's suggested to get in touch with regional regulations for details needs and guidelines


Just how Do I Establish My Residential Or Commercial Property Borders?



To figure out residential property borders, one can evaluate building acts, seek advice from with a surveyor, or check neighborhood tax assessor maps. These methods offer quality on specific lines and help prevent conflicts with next-door neighbors.


Are There HOA Regulations for Fencing in My Area?





Homeowners associations usually establish particular regulations concerning secure fencing, including height, materials, and design. To guarantee conformity, people should review their HOA's standards or speak with board members for clearness on any kind of constraints in their location.
